APLA and Turkish Cooperation and Coordination Agency (TİKA) discuss ways to promote development programmes in support of the Palestinian people

In the Turkish capital, Ankara, Abdul Karim az-Zubeidi, President of the Association of Palestinian Local Authorities (APLA), held a meeting with Serkan Kayalar, President of the Turkish Cooperation and Coordination Agency (TİKA), to examine ways to promote mutual cooperation with a view to implementing development programmes in support of the Palestinian people in general, and local government units (LGUs) in particular.

 

Commending TİKA role in implementing a large number of projects around the world, particularly in Palestine, Az-Zubeidi stressed that tangible progress has been made in the Palestinian territory thanks to this support, which seeks to strengthen the Palestinian people’s resilience. In the spirit of partnership and cooperation, it reflects the depth of distinctive bilateral relations between both countries and Turkish support of Palestine at all levels. Az-Zubeidi stressed the importance of maintaining the continuity of this cooperation.

 

Kayalar confirmed TİKA’s position in support of the Palestinian cause as well as the high level of cooperation and coordination with Palestinian institutions. Kayalar made clear that TİKA was ready to consolidate and develop cooperation to serve Palestinian LGUs in view of the role they play in facilitating the Agency’s operations and implementing project.

 

The meeting was held in the context of the efforts made to strengthen bilateral relations and cooperation between both parties and discuss future projects, which can support and develop Palestinian communities in various areas.
